Users & Groups Missing from System Preferences
Hello,
I'm missing Users & Groups from System Preferences from my MacBook Pro which is running Lion Mac OS X 10.7.2. My original issue was that System Preferences would not open. It would open quickly with a blank window and then close. I deleted the System Preferences cache folder and rebooted. System Preferences opened and everything is there except for Users & Groups.
I tried opening Users & Groups through the help center but received this error message: "This item cannot be opened. It may be disabled or not installed. 2 param error." Is there anyway to re-enable this? Or is there a way to set the MacBook Pro back to factory default? Unfortunately I don't have the media to reinstall the OS so I'm hoping there is a quick resolution.
